About the Author:
Pradip Ninan Thomas is at the School of Communication and Arts, University of Queensland. He has written widely on the media in India, the political economy of communications, communications for social change and the media and religion in globally renowned journals inclusive of the Journal of Communication, Media, Culture & Society., the European Journal of Communications and the Economic & Political Weekly. His most recent books include 'Communications for Social Change: Context, Social Movement and the Digital (2018), Empire & Post-Empire Telecommunications in India: A History (2019). Acknowledgements List of Abbreviations Section I: Introduction 1) The Politics of Digital India: Between Local Compulsions and Transnational Pressures Section II: The Control State 2) The Expansion of Politics as Control: Surveillance in India 3) Leisure, Surveillance and the Private Sector in India 4) Software Patent Manoeuvres Section III: The Sovereign/Ambivalent State? 5) Digital (Transgenic) Seed and its Copy 6) The Contested Nature of Internet Governance 7) The WIPO Treaty for the Visually Impaired as a Double Movement Section IV: Concluding Chapter 8) Digital India and the Politics and Geopolitics of Information References Index About the Author
